Add a tuning box to a GTD and you’ll have something to smile about.
Add an oily filter and all you’ve got is an excuse by VW to wag a finger at you about warranties.
Seriously they do nothing unless you have a lot of other tuning going on. Diesels suck a lot of air so just cleaning your air box out once in a while and banging anything loose from your paper filter will keep it running just fine.
